10/5 - Bush and Kerry on the Oceans: "The who-whats?"

What do the presidential candidates have to say about the fate of our oceans? Apparently not much. At least not when Physics Today is doing the interviewing. They quizzed both candidates on what they felt are the 7 most important issues in science: Missile Defense, Climate Change, Science Investment, Nuclear Weapons, Nuclear Proliferation, Energy Policy, Nuclear Power, and National Laboratories. Perhaps it says more about the interests of physicists, but still, if the noise being made about the oceans today were loud enough (as it is for climate change) it would have somehow been on their list.
